Female sex bias and kinship in Iberian megalithic societies: an interdisciplinary analysis of bioarchaeology, aDNA and proteomics

Traditional osteological methods in biological sex estimation can now be overcome with genomic and proteomic analyses. The combination of the three methodologies has been used for a better understanding of gender-related funerary rituals of the Iberian megalithic cemetery of Panoría. As a result, 44 individuals have been sexed including for the first time non-adults. Contrary to the male bias found in many Iberian and European megalithic monuments, the Panoría population shows a clear sex ratio imbalance in favour of females, with twice as many females as males. Furthermore, this imbalance is found regardless of the criterion considered: sex ratio by tomb, chronological period, method of sex estimation or age group. Biological relatedness and kinship have been explored as cultural explanations for this female-related bias. The results obtained for Panoría are indicative of a female-centred social structure in which sex and/or gender would have influenced funerary rites and cultural traditions.
